Output 156f136a6194a1303b89a30429ef3c5f6ebedb64afd961b220b0ab05b4ff92b3:0

value
200000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f8840ff7215d696772a0a79446544c8e0b95b1c OP_EQUALVERIFY OP_CHECKSIG
address
13sjB2woFJ7Jbx1JYsuTLCazxLPH3LNbPD
transaction
156f136a6194a1303b89a30429ef3c5f6ebedb64afd961b220b0ab05b4ff92b3
spent
true